Karl Weick
A prominent organizational theorist known for his work on sensemaking in organizations, which explores how people construct meaning from their experiences.
Mechanical Principles
The basic laws and concepts of physics that apply to mechanical systems, including motion, forces, energy, and the properties of materials.
Nonsummativity
The principle that the whole is greater than the sum of its parts, often cited in contexts like teamwork and organizational behavior.
Systems Perspective
An analytical approach that views entities as complex wholes comprised of interrelated parts, suggesting that understanding each part requires context of the entire system.
